Abstract:

Digitalisation opens far-reaching possibilities for teachers and learners to increase the effectiveness and efficiency of education. In this context, virtual training is becoming increasingly relevant, and its design can be constantly optimised through technical progress such as the integration of haptic elements in virtual training scenarios. This type of technology is gaining importance due to its promising perspectives. Additional haptic elements in virtual space can, in the appropriate use case, enhance the learning experience and thus digitally simplify complex forms of competence acquisition. This applies to different industries, whereby the usefulness of integrating a sense of touch in training varies between use cases.
